Well, New Orleans decided to play the spoiler against Houston and put the Rockets away in overtime. This means that the Hornets have tied the Kings in the win column. This may actually turn out well for the Kings, because the Hornets have a game against the tank-tastic Warriors left, to counter our game against the miserable Hornets. The Pistons, on the other hand, staved off a win at home against the very injured T'Wolves, breaking Minny's 11-game losing streak by shooting 36% for the day.
Tomorrow there are three meaningful games in Tank City. Naturally there's our matchup hosting the Thunder, who we beat at PBP earlier in the season, a mistake we are unlikely to repeat now that we are starting Tyreke Evans at the 3. In addition, Cleveland hosts the Knicks, who have clinched a playoff spot and are really only fighting for 7/8 positioning - Chicago or Miami? Doesn't really matter, so the Knicks might slack off and let Cleveland accidentally win one. Finally, Golden State travels to Dallas. Dallas has not yet clinched a playoff spot and Golden State is tanking as hard as any team has ever done because if their pick ends up #8 or higher, they lose it to Utah. In other words, don't count on GS winning. They'll lose by 40.
